HOW LONG TO GRILL PORK TENDERLION

Setting your grill to 350 F degrees will have your pork tenderloin cooked in 12 – 15 minutes.

HOW TO GRILL BBQ PORK TENDERLOIN MEDALLIONS

  • First, your going to want to take a pork tenderloin and slice it into 1 inch thick medallions. 
  • Then, place those medallions in a container or plastic zip lock bag and marinade them in all the seasonings and spices for a minimum of 1 hour. 
  • Then in a non stick skillet, preferably a cast iron one. You will want to grill them till lightly browned. Feel free to grill them on an outside grill if desired.
  • Remove the medallions from the sauce (save the sauce)
  • And sear the medallions on each side till lightly browned.
  • Then add in the sauce to a non stick cast iron skillet and sauté till well done. 
  • Serve over rice or mashed potatoes and a veggie of your liking.

HOW TO SLOW COOK PORK TENDERLOIN

You can also place the Pork Tenderloin into the slow cooker and let it cook in the sauce that way for 8 hours. Then remove and slice, placing back in the slow cooker to brown on either side on the sauté setting.

The trick to cooking the best bbq pork tenderloin is to ensure you are browning the meat once it has been marinated then adding back in the marinade to finish the recipe off.

The second trick is to season the bqq pork tenderloin medallions generously on both sides with salt and pepper prior to browning.

If you follow those two tips alone you are sure to prepare the best bbq pork tenderloin.

Grilled Bbq Pork Tenderloin Medallions

Yield: 3
Prep Time: 5 minutes
Cook Time: 16 minutes
Total Time: 21 minutes

Browned on the outside, tender and juicy on the inside. 

Ingredients

  • 1 pork tenderloin
  • 4 tbsp of Butter
  • 1/2 cup of bbq sauce
  • 1 tsp garlic powder
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. Start by slicing the pork tenderloin into medallions bite size pieces.
  2. Season all over with garlic powder, salt and pepper
  3. Marinade in a bag with your favorite bbq sauce for a min of 1 hour (in the fridge)
  4. Heat a skillet and place the remaining butter and sear on both sides till well cooked.

Notes

  • Each side will take about 5 minutes to cook, while cooking baste constantly with butter in the pan.
  • These medallions can be done on the grill as well, they just won't be as juicy.
  • Feel free to use fresh garlic instead, just add it in near the last 2 minutes while cooking.
